The Climate Risk in Cities Solution Booklet is a comprehensive guide developed by the Smart Cities Marketplace. This Solution Booklet aims to address the pressing issue of climate risks faced by urban areas across Europe. As Europe experiences rapid warming, cities are becoming increasingly vulnerable to extreme weather events, including heat waves, floods, and droughts. The booklet provides a detailed framework for understanding and assessing climate risks, offering practical solutions for city officials to enhance urban resilience.

Key topics covered include the identification and assessment of climate risks, the role of climate services, and the importance of governance and communication in managing these risks. The booklet also highlights various adaptation options, from green and blue infrastructure to technological and policy measures, ensuring cities can effectively mitigate and adapt to the impacts of climate change. By integrating scientific data with local knowledge and engaging stakeholders, the booklet serves as a vital resource for cities striving to achieve a sustainable and climate-resilient future
